image
Financial Services - Asset Management - NYSE - US
$ 19.16
-0.322 %
$ 2.3 B
Market Cap
10.46
P/E
1. INTRINSIC VALUE

This DCF valuation model was last updated on Jun, 6, 2025.

The intrinsic value of one ECC-PD stock under the worst case scenario is HIDDEN Compared to the current market price of 19.2 USD, Eagle Point Credit Company Inc. is HIDDEN

This DCF valuation model was last updated on Jun, 6, 2025.

The intrinsic value of one ECC-PD stock under the base case scenario is HIDDEN Compared to the current market price of 19.2 USD, Eagle Point Credit Company Inc. is HIDDEN

This DCF valuation model was last updated on Jun, 6, 2025.

The intrinsic value of one ECC-PD stock under the best case scenario is HIDDEN Compared to the current market price of 19.2 USD, Eagle Point Credit Company Inc. is HIDDEN

2. FUNDAMENTAL ANALYSIS

Price Chart ECC-PD

image
$20.2$20.2$20.0$20.0$19.8$19.8$19.6$19.6$19.4$19.4$19.2$19.2$19.0$19.0$18.8$18.8$18.6$18.6$18.4$18.4$18.2$18.2$18.0$18.015 Dec15 DecJan '25Jan '2515 Jan15 JanFeb '25Feb '2515 Feb15 FebMar '25Mar '2515 Mar15 MarApr '25Apr '2515 Apr15 AprMay '25May '2515 May15 MayJun '25Jun '25
FINANCIALS
97.6 M REVENUE
-29.81%
85.5 M OPERATING INCOME
-15.48%
80.3 M NET INCOME
-31.29%
-429 M OPERATING CASH FLOW
-425.93%
0 INVESTING CASH FLOW
0.00%
424 M FINANCING CASH FLOW
494.93%
35.8 M REVENUE
-12.03%
51.2 M OPERATING INCOME
340.30%
45.3 M NET INCOME
1073.04%
24.5 M OPERATING CASH FLOW
-12.93%
-165 M INVESTING CASH FLOW
-2.13%
158 M FINANCING CASH FLOW
123.48%
Balance Sheet Eagle Point Credit Company Inc.
image
Current Assets 42.2 M
Cash & Short-Term Investments 42.2 M
Receivables 54.8 M
Other Current Assets -54.8 M
Non-Current Assets 1.41 B
Long-Term Investments 1.41 B
PP&E 0
Other Non-Current Assets 0
2.91 %3.78 %97.09 %Total Assets$1.4b
Current Liabilities 0
Accounts Payable 43.9 M
Short-Term Debt 0
Other Current Liabilities -43.9 M
Non-Current Liabilities 0
Long-Term Debt 0
Other Non-Current Liabilities 0
Infinity %Total Liabilities$0.0
EFFICIENCY
Earnings Waterfall Eagle Point Credit Company Inc.
image
Revenue 97.6 M
Cost Of Revenue 0
Gross Profit 97.6 M
Operating Expenses 12.1 M
Operating Income 85.5 M
Other Expenses 5.18 M
Net Income 80.3 M
100m100m90m90m80m80m70m70m60m60m50m50m40m40m30m30m20m20m10m10m0098m098m(12m)85m(5m)80mRevenueRevenueCost Of RevenueCost Of RevenueGross ProfitGross ProfitOperating ExpensesOperating ExpensesOperating IncomeOperating IncomeOther ExpensesOther ExpensesNet IncomeNet Income
RATIOS
100.00% GROSS MARGIN
100.00%
87.58% OPERATING MARGIN
87.58%
87.58% NET MARGIN
87.58%
9.13% ROE
9.13%
5.68% ROA
5.68%
5.90% ROIC
5.90%
FREE CASH FLOW ANALYSIS
Free Cash Flow Analysis Eagle Point Credit Company Inc.
image
50m50m00(50m)(50m)(100m)(100m)(150m)(150m)(200m)(200m)(250m)(250m)(300m)(300m)(350m)(350m)(400m)(400m)(450m)(450m)20162016201720172018201820192019202020202021202120222022202320232024202420252025
Net Income 80.3 M
Depreciation & Amortization 0
Capital Expenditures 0
Stock-Based Compensation 0
Change in Working Capital -1.92 M
Others -503 M
Free Cash Flow -429 M
3. WALL STREET ANALYSTS ESTIMATES
Wall Street Analysts Price Targets Eagle Point Credit Company Inc.
image
ECC-PD has no price targets from Wall Street.
4. DIVIDEND ANALYSIS
3.26% DIVIDEND YIELD
0.141 USD DIVIDEND PER SHARE
Q1
Q2
Q3
Q4
0.800000.800000.700000.700000.600000.600000.500000.500000.400000.400000.300000.300000.200000.200000.100000.100000.000000.000000.150.140630.140630.140630.140630.140630.140630.140630.140630.140630.140630.140630.140630.140630.140630.140630.140630.140630.140630.140630.140630.140630.140630.140630.140630.140630.140630.140630.140630.140630.140630.140630.140630.140630.140630.140630.140630.140630.570.140630.560.140630.560.140630.560.281250.700.140630.560.140630.560.140630.560.140630.560.420.420.420.1420222022202320232024202420252025
Download SVG
Download PNG
Download CSV
5. COMPETITION
6. Ownership
Insider Ownership Eagle Point Credit Company Inc.
image
Sold
0-3 MONTHS
0 USD 0
3-6 MONTHS
0 USD 0
6-9 MONTHS
0 USD 0
9-12 MONTHS
0 USD 0
Bought
0 USD 0
0-3 MONTHS
0 USD 0
3-6 MONTHS
0 USD 0
6-9 MONTHS
0 USD 0
9-12 MONTHS
7. News
8. Profile Summary

Eagle Point Credit Company Inc. ECC-PD

image
COUNTRY US
INDUSTRY Asset Management
MARKET CAP $ 2.3 B
Dividend Yield 3.26%
Description Eagle Point Credit Company Inc. is a closed ended fund launched and managed by Eagle Point Credit Management LLC. It invests in fixed income markets of the United States. The fund invests equity and junior debt tranches of collateralized loan obligations consisting primarily of below investment grade U.S. senior secured loans. Eagle Point Credit Company Inc. was formed on March 24, 2014 and is domiciled in the United States.
Contact 20 Horseneck Lane, Greenwich, CT, 06830 https://www.eaglepointcreditcompany.com
IPO Date Nov. 23, 2021
Employees None
Officers Ms. Courtney Barrett Fandrick Secretary Mr. Kyle William McGrady Director of Marketing and Investor Relations Mr. Nauman S. Malik J.D. General Counsel & Chief Compliance Officer Mr. Thomas Philip Majewski CPA Chief Executive Officer & Interested Director